Originally Posted by dizzle88 View Post
Yeah not sure how I feel about it, Bell had a pro bowl level season at 25 years old (I think) and we let him go in favour of a 32 year old.
He didn’t grade out as a Pro Bowl level safety. He finished with a 64.6.

Jamal Adams was the SS for the AFC. He had an 88.2.

Harrison Smith was the NFC guy. 89.8

Bell wasn’t anywhere near that ball park. Malcolm Jenkins ended up with a 68.6. Not particularly great either, but better than Bell. CJG had a 72.6 though. Now that’s what I call an ascending young player.

These grades aren’t everything, but they do tend to tell a pretty good story.
